-/*
- * arch/v850/lib/memcpy.c -- Memory copying
- *
- *  Copyright (C) 2001,02  NEC Corporation
- *  Copyright (C) 2001,02  Miles Bader <miles@gnu.org>
- *
- * This file is subject to the terms and conditions of the GNU General
- * Public License.  See the file COPYING in the main directory of this
- * archive for more details.
- *
- * Written by Miles Bader <miles@gnu.org>
- */
-
-#include <linux/types.h>
-#include <asm/string.h>
-
-#define CHUNK_SIZE		32 /* bytes */
-#define CHUNK_ALIGNED(addr)	(((unsigned long)addr & 0x3) == 0)
-
-/* Note that this macro uses 8 call-clobbered registers (not including
-   R1), which are few enough so that the following functions don't need
-   to spill anything to memory.  It also uses R1, which is nominally
-   reserved for the assembler, but here it should be OK.  */
-#define COPY_CHUNK(src, dst)			\
-   asm ("mov %0, ep;"				\
-	"sld.w 0[ep], r1; sld.w 4[ep], r12;"	\
-	"sld.w 8[ep], r13; sld.w 12[ep], r14;"	\
-	"sld.w 16[ep], r15; sld.w 20[ep], r17;"	\
-	"sld.w 24[ep], r18; sld.w 28[ep], r19;"	\
-	"mov %1, ep;"				\
-	"sst.w r1, 0[ep]; sst.w r12, 4[ep];"	\
-	"sst.w r13, 8[ep]; sst.w r14, 12[ep];"	\
-	"sst.w r15, 16[ep]; sst.w r17, 20[ep];"	\
-	"sst.w r18, 24[ep]; sst.w r19, 28[ep]"	\
-	:: "r" (src), "r" (dst)			\
-	: "r1", "r12", "r13", "r14", "r15",	\
-	  "r17", "r18", "r19", "ep", "memory");
-
-void *memcpy (void *dst, const void *src, __kernel_size_t size)
-{
-	char *_dst = dst;
-	const char *_src = src;
-
-	if (size >= CHUNK_SIZE && CHUNK_ALIGNED(_src) && CHUNK_ALIGNED(_dst)) {
-		/* Copy large blocks efficiently.  */
-		unsigned count;
-		for (count = size / CHUNK_SIZE; count; count--) {
-			COPY_CHUNK (_src, _dst);
-			_src += CHUNK_SIZE;
-			_dst += CHUNK_SIZE;
-		}
-		size %= CHUNK_SIZE;
-	}
-
-	if (size > 0)
-		do
-			*_dst++ = *_src++;
-		while (--size);
-
-	return dst;
-}
-
-void *memmove (void *dst, const void *src, __kernel_size_t size)
-{
-	if ((unsigned long)dst < (unsigned long)src
-	    || (unsigned long)src + size < (unsigned long)dst)
-		return memcpy (dst, src, size);
-	else {
-		char *_dst = dst + size;
-		const char *_src = src + size;
-
-		if (size >= CHUNK_SIZE
-		    && CHUNK_ALIGNED (_src) && CHUNK_ALIGNED (_dst))
-		{
-			/* Copy large blocks efficiently.  */
-			unsigned count;
-			for (count = size / CHUNK_SIZE; count; count--) {
-				_src -= CHUNK_SIZE;
-				_dst -= CHUNK_SIZE;
-				COPY_CHUNK (_src, _dst);
-			}
-			size %= CHUNK_SIZE;
-		}
-
-		if (size > 0)
-			do
-				*--_dst = *--_src;
-			while (--size);
-
-		return _dst;
-	}
-}
